    This was an a fairly simply casserole to make. I cut the cream in half and added 1% milk - tasted fine. My husband doesn't like mushroom, so I left them out but I believe they would be great in it. The sauce is very good and not too difficult to make.I had a left over bag of chips from a party, and this was a good use for them.

    Way to go Emeril! Tried many recipes for Tetrazzini and this is the tops. Great filling casserole especially after a Thanksgiving dinner. Followed recipe exactly except used topping of bread crumbs, parmesan and butter instead of potato chips. They might be kid friendly but for adults prefer the other. As for cooking instructions very easy though the sauce thickened in about 3 minutes so don't overcook. Try it you will like it!
